Breaking Down the Features of Magpul M-Lok 5 Slot Polymer 2.5″ Black

Specifications

  • The Magpul M-Lok 5 Slot Polymer 2.5″ Black features five slots for attaching Picatinny-compatible accessories. This offers enough space for most common attachments like lights, lasers, or foregrips.
  • It is constructed from a proprietary reinforced composite polymer. This provides a balance between lightweight design and durability, resisting impacts and temperature fluctuations.
  • The overall length is 2.5 inches, minimizing added bulk to the firearm. This keeps the rifle streamlined and easy to handle.
  • The rail section is finished in black, providing a non-reflective surface. This is beneficial for tactical applications.
  • It is made in the USA. This reinforces the Magpul commitment to quality and domestic manufacturing.

These specifications are important because they directly impact the rail section’s utility. The polymer construction ensures that it won’t add unnecessary weight to the firearm. The five slots are sufficient for most attachments, and the 2.5-inch length keeps the profile low.

Performance & Functionality

The Magpul M-Lok 5 Slot Polymer 2.5″ Black performs its intended function exceptionally well. It securely attaches Picatinny accessories to M-Lok compatible handguards and forends, providing a stable platform for operation. One key strength is its lightweight design, which prevents the rifle from becoming front-heavy.

However, one weakness is that polymer is not as rigid as aluminum. Under extreme stress, such as supporting a heavy bipod with significant pressure applied, the rail section may exhibit some flex, as noted in the user feedback. While it may not be ideal for demanding applications like long-range precision shooting with a heavy bipod, it excels in most other scenarios.

Who Should Buy Magpul M-Lok 5 Slot Polymer 2.5″ Black?

The Magpul M-Lok 5 Slot Polymer 2.5″ Black is perfect for shooters looking to add accessories to their M-Lok compatible firearms without significantly increasing weight or cost. It’s ideal for recreational shooters, home defense users, and those building lightweight AR-15 platforms. This rail section is also suitable for those who prioritize ease of installation and compatibility with a wide range of accessories.

This product might not be ideal for precision shooters using heavy bipods or those who require maximum rigidity in their accessory mounting platform. For such demanding applications, an aluminum rail section might be a better choice.
